Transaction 637bff0d80da7eb58bb5e9d960f1304791148d93dd8b18768f4c2960726c55bb
1 Input
1 Output
-
637bff0d80da7eb58bb5e9d960f1304791148d93dd8b18768f4c2960726c55bb:0
- value
- 32677916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d2b6dab8a690a9466011d40056a5c1621b65844 OP_EQUAL
- address
- 35orMdjbNa1A9qkuFH7w8YxrC1TDTy17HQ